  1. Hi everyone I hope everyone here is safe and healthy. This year is very crazy, but we decided to move on. We don't want to stick with Adobe path anymore and want to move to Affinity's products, started by Publisher. However, one key component missing from our workflow is Affinity's version of Acrobat Pro that we use for pdf pre-flight. On the other hand, I found on your website that Publisher has pre-flight feature built-in. Let's say, I have a pdf with 16 pages, is there any way in Publisher to place that 16 page pdf easily (not place the pdf page by page) and pre-flight the file in Publisher with placed pdf for any potential problem (especially for low-resolution images)? Of course, I don't need to edit that pdf, that means I don't need to "open or import" the pdf and make it editable.
